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ix VK272 - This change requires a reorganization of condition indexes.


SAP Error Message - Details

  • Message type: E = Error

  • Message class: VK - Pflege und Bearbeitung von Konditionen

  • Message number: 272

  • Message text: This change requires a reorganization of condition indexes.

  • Show details Hide details
  • How to fix this error?

    The reorganization of condition indexes is to be carried out in
    Customizing for Sales and Distribution. If necessary, contact your
    system administrator.

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message VK272 - This change requires a reorganization of condition indexes. ?

    The SAP error message VK272, which states "This change requires a reorganization of condition indexes," typically occurs when there are changes made to condition records in pricing, such as changes to the condition type, access sequence, or other related settings. This error indicates that the condition indexes need to be reorganized to reflect the changes made.

    Cause:

    1. Changes in Condition Records: Modifications to condition records (like adding, deleting, or changing conditions) can lead to inconsistencies in the condition indexes.
    2. Configuration Changes: Changes in the configuration of pricing procedures, access sequences, or condition types can also trigger this error.
    3. Data Consistency Issues: If the condition indexes are not updated after changes, it can lead to data inconsistency, which SAP identifies and flags with this error.

    Solution:

    To resolve the VK272 error, you need to reorganize the condition indexes. Here are the steps to do this:

    1. Transaction Code: Use transaction code VK12 or VK31 to access the condition records.
    2. Reorganize Condition Indexes:
      • Go to transaction code SDBONT or SDBON (depending on your SAP version).
      • Execute the report for reorganizing condition indexes. This can also be done through transaction VK11 or VK12 by selecting the appropriate options to reorganize.
      • Alternatively, you can use transaction SE38 to run the program RM06BIND or RM06BIND2 to reorganize the condition indexes.
    3. Check for Errors: After running the reorganization, check for any errors or messages that may indicate further issues.
    4. Test the Changes: After the reorganization, test the pricing conditions to ensure that they are functioning correctly and that the error message no longer appears.

    Related Information:

    • Condition Indexes: These are used by SAP to speed up the retrieval of condition records during pricing calculations. They store the condition records in a structured way to allow for quick access.
    • Transaction Codes: Familiarize yourself with relevant transaction codes such as VK11, VK12, VK31, and VK32 for managing condition records.
    • SAP Notes: Check SAP Notes for any specific patches or updates related to this error message, as there may be known issues or additional steps required based on your SAP version.
    • Documentation: Review SAP documentation on pricing and condition records for a deeper understanding of how condition indexes work and best practices for managing them.

    By following these steps, you should be able to resolve the VK272 error and ensure that your condition indexes are properly updated.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
The AI Support Assistant is great. It provides comprehensive assistance even on the most difficult issues. I highly recommend this service.
Rate 1
John Jordan
SAP Consultant & Author